9. What formula could be used to find the area of the image?

10. Identify the dimensions that will be used in the formula in number 9.

11. What is the area of the image?

Answer:

9. Area of triangle=
(1)/(2) * base* height

10. Base= 16 ft and Height= 15 ft.

11. 120 ft²

Explanation:

Given: Base of triangle= 16 ft

Length of leg of triangle= 17 ft.

As shown in the picture that median has bisected the triangle and forming two right angle triangle.

∴ Each base of right angle triangle=
(16)/(2) = 8\ feet

Now, finding the height of triangle by using pythagorean theorem.

We know,
h^(2) = a^(2) +b^(2), where h is hypotenous, a is height or opposite and b is base or adjacent of triangle.


17^(2)= a^(2) + 8^(2)


289= a^(2) + 64

Subtracting both side by 64


225= a^(2)

taking square root on both side, remember; √a²=a

⇒a=
√(225) = 15

Hence, height of triangle is 15 ft.

Next, finding the area of triangle.

Formula; Area of triangle=
(1)/(2) * base* height

⇒ Area of triangle=
(1)/(2) * 16* 15

∴ Area of triangle= 120 ft²
